Our Specialized Smart Toilet Installation Process

Smart toilet installation requires precision and expertise beyond standard toilet replacement. The process begins with a comprehensive site assessment to evaluate your existing plumbing configuration electrical availability and space constraints. Most Birmingham homes built before 2000 lack the dedicated GFCI outlet required for smart toilet operation necessitating professional electrical work.

The installation process follows these critical steps:

  1. Site Assessment and Planning

    We evaluate your current toilet location measure rough-in dimensions and assess electrical access. This step identifies any code compliance issues specific to Oakland County requirements. Oakland County Building Department.

  2. Fixture Removal and Preparation

    Your existing toilet gets removed the wax ring gets replaced and the flange gets inspected for proper elevation and stability. Birmingham’s older homes often require flange repair or replacement due to decades of use.

  3. Electrical Installation

    A dedicated 120V GFCI outlet gets installed within 4 feet of the toilet location per NEC Article 210.8 requirements for bathroom receptacle placement. This ensures safe operation of the smart toilet’s electrical components.

  4. Smart Toilet Installation

    The new fixture gets carefully positioned connected to the water supply and leveled. All connections get tested for leaks and the toilet gets secured to the floor with proper mounting hardware.

  5. System Calibration and Testing

    Electronic sensors get calibrated water pressure gets adjusted to manufacturer specifications and all smart functions get tested. This includes bidet spray pressure heated seat temperature and automatic flushing mechanisms.

The entire installation typically requires 3-4 hours for a straightforward replacement though electrical work can extend this timeline. Our team carries all necessary Oakland County permits and ensures every installation meets Michigan Residential Code standards for both plumbing and electrical components.

Premium Smart Toilet Brands We Install

We specialize in installing the most reliable smart toilet brands available in the Birmingham market. Each brand offers unique features suited to different preferences and budgets. Finding a Reliable Emergency Plumber in Midtown Detroit When Your Pipes Burst.

Brand Key Features Installation Complexity Price Range
Toto Neorest EWATER+ cleaning Actilight self-cleaning automatic lid High – requires precise electrical calibration $4500-$7000
Kohler Konnect Touchless flushing heated seat night light Medium – standard electrical requirements $2800-$4200
Woodbridge B0970S Smart bidet functions tankless heating deodorizer Medium – simpler electrical setup $1200-$1800
Bio Bidet Bliss HydroFlush cleaning adjustable spray patterns Low – minimal electrical requirements $800-$1400

Toto Neorest installations require the most technical expertise due to their advanced water purification system and automatic cleaning functions. These units use electrolyzed water to sanitize the bowl after each use reducing the need for harsh chemical cleaners. The Actilight technology combines ultraviolet light with a special glaze to break down waste and bacteria. Toto Neorest smart toilets.

Kohler Konnect models offer excellent integration with smart home systems allowing voice control through Alexa or Google Home. These units feature precision-engineered bidet functions with adjustable pressure and temperature settings making them popular among Birmingham homeowners who value both luxury and convenience.

Birmingham MI Plumbing Codes and Permit Requirements

Smart toilet installations in Birmingham must comply with Oakland County plumbing codes and Michigan Residential Code requirements. The most critical compliance issue involves the dedicated GFCI electrical circuit which must get installed by a licensed electrician or qualified plumber familiar with NEC Article 210.8 requirements.

Oakland County requires permits for all new plumbing fixture installations that involve changes to the existing drainage system or water supply. Smart toilets typically qualify for permit exemption when replacing existing toilets in the same location but the electrical work triggers separate permitting requirements. Our team handles all necessary permit applications through the Oakland County Building Department.

Water pressure requirements for smart toilets range from 20-80 PSI with optimal performance at 40-60 PSI. Birmingham’s municipal water system typically provides adequate pressure but homes with well systems or pressure-reducing valves may require adjustments. We test water pressure during the initial assessment and make recommendations for booster pumps or pressure regulators if needed.

Backflow prevention represents another critical code consideration. Smart toilets with bidet functions must include built-in backflow prevention devices to prevent contaminated water from entering the clean water supply. All units we install meet or exceed Michigan Department of Environmental Quality standards for cross-connection control.

Smart Toilet Maintenance for Birmingham’s Hard Water

Birmingham’s water supply contains high mineral content that can affect smart toilet performance over time. Calcium and magnesium deposits can accumulate on sensors nozzles and internal valves causing malfunctions or reduced efficiency. Regular maintenance prevents these issues and extends the life of your investment.

Monthly cleaning of the bidet nozzle and sensors prevents mineral buildup. We recommend using a 50-50 vinegar solution to dissolve deposits without damaging the electronic components. The self-cleaning functions on premium models like Toto Neorest reduce manual cleaning requirements but occasional deep cleaning remains necessary.

Water filtration systems can significantly reduce maintenance needs. Whole-house water softeners or point-of-use filters installed at the toilet supply line prevent mineral accumulation. These systems typically cost $300-$800 installed and pay for themselves through reduced maintenance and extended fixture life. Sensor calibration may be needed annually to maintain optimal performance. Temperature sensors can drift over time causing inconsistent heated seat temperatures or water heating. Our maintenance service includes comprehensive system testing sensor recalibration and firmware updates when available from manufacturers.

Frequently Asked Questions

Do I need an electrician for smart toilet installation?

Yes smart toilets require a dedicated GFCI electrical outlet within 4 feet of the fixture. This must get installed by a licensed professional to meet NEC Article 210.8 requirements for bathroom receptacle placement. Our team includes qualified electricians who handle this work as part of the installation process.

How long does smart toilet installation take?

A standard replacement typically requires 3-4 hours when electrical work is already in place. If new electrical circuits are needed the timeline extends to 6-8 hours total with some work potentially completed on a separate day to allow for electrical inspections and drywall repair.

Can I keep my existing toilet while waiting for installation?

Most installations can get completed in a single day allowing you to use your existing toilet until the new unit is ready. However we recommend scheduling installation when you can be without bathroom access for 4-6 hours to ensure proper testing and calibration.

Are smart toilets worth the investment?

Smart toilets typically cost $800-$7000 installed but they offer significant benefits including water savings of 20-30 percent compared to standard toilets enhanced hygiene through bidet functions and luxury features that increase home value. Many Birmingham homeowners find the comfort and convenience justify the investment.
